A payment agreement contract is an essential document that outlines the terms and conditions of a payment arrangement between two parties. Whether you’re a freelancer, contractor, or small business owner, it’s crucial to have a written contract to avoid misunderstandings and disputes. Introduction
The payment agreement contract is entered into between [company name] (the “Client”) and [contractor/freelancer name] (the “Freelancer/Contractor”) on [date of agreement].
Scope of Work
The Freelancer/Contractor shall provide [type of services] to the Client according to the following terms:
– [Detailed description of services to be provided]
– [Expected timeline for completion]
– [Expected number of revisions, if any]
Payment
The Client shall pay the Freelancer/Contractor [amount] for the services provided. The payment shall be made as follows:
– [Amount to be paid upfront (if any)]
– [Payment schedule or due dates]
– [Payment method and currency]
Late Payment
In the event that the Client fails to make any payment on the due date, a late payment fee of [amount] shall be charged for each day that the payment remains outstanding.
Project Changes
If there are any changes to the scope of work or timeline, the Client shall communicate them to the Freelancer/Contractor as soon as possible. Any changes to the project may result in a change to the payment amount or timeline.
Ownership and Copyright
The Freelancer/Contractor shall retain ownership of any materials created during the project until the full payment has been made. Once the full payment has been received, the Client shall own the copyright to any materials created during the project.
Confidentiality
The Freelancer/Contractor shall keep all client information and project details confidential and shall not share them with any third party without the Client’s prior written consent.
Termination
Either party may terminate this agreement upon written notice if the other party breaches any of the terms and conditions of this Agreement.
Governing Law
This Agreement shall be governed by and construed in accordance with the laws of [state/country].
Entire Agreement
This Agreement constitutes the entire agreement between the parties and supersedes all prior agreements and understandings, whether written or oral.
